Intel 64 and IA-32 Architectures Software Developers Manual Volume 1, Basic Architecture

Vol. 1 2-21
INTEL
®
64 AND IA-32 ARCHITECTURES
Table 2-1. Key Features of Most Recent IA-32 Processors
Intel
Processor
Date
Intro-
duced
Micro-
architec-
ture
Top-Bin
Clock
Frequency
at Intro-
duction
Tran-
sistors
Register
Sizes
1
System
Bus
Band-
width
Max.
Extern.
Addr.
Space
On-Die
Caches
2
Intel Pentium M
Processor 755
3
2004 Intel Pentium M
Processor
2.00 GHz 140 M GP: 32
FPU: 80
MMX: 64
XMM: 128
3.2 GB/s 4 GB L1: 64 KB
L2: 2 MB
Intel Core Duo
Processor
T2600
3
2006 Improved Intel
Pentium M
Processor
Microarchitecture;
Dual Core;
Intel Smart
Cache, Advanced
Thermal Manager
2.16 GHz 152M GP: 32
FPU: 80
MMX: 64
XMM: 128
5.3 GB/s 4 GB L1: 64 KB
L2: 2 MB (2MB
Tota l)
NOTES:
1. The register size and external data bus size are given in bits.
2. First level cache is denoted using the abbreviation L1, 2nd level cache is denoted as L2. The size
of L1 includes the first-level data cache and the instruction cache where applicable, but does not
include the trace cache.
3. Intel processor numbers are not a measure of performance. Processor numbers differentiate fea-
tures within each processor family, not across different processor families.
See
http://www.intel.com/products/processor_number for details.
Table 2-2. Key Features of Most Recent Intel 64 Processors
Intel
Processor
Date
Intro-
duced
Micro-
architec-
ture
Top-Bin
Clock
Frequency
at Intro-
duction
Tran-
sistors
Register
Sizes
System
Bus
Band-
width
Max.
Extern.
Addr.
Space
On-Die
Caches
64-bit Intel
Xeon
Processor with
800 MHz
System Bus
2004 Intel NetBurst
Microarchitecture;
Hyper-Threading
Technology; Intel
64 Architecture
3.60 GHz 125 M GP: 32, 64
FPU: 80
MMX: 64
XMM: 128
6.4 GB/s 64 GB 12K µop
Execution
Trace Cache;
16 KB L1;
1 MB L2
64-bit Intel
Xeon
Processor MP
with 8MB L3
2005 Intel NetBurst
Microarchitecture;
Hyper-Threading
Technology; Intel
64 Architecture
3.33 GHz 675M GP: 32, 64
FPU: 80
MMX: 64
XMM: 128
5.3 GB/s
1
1024 GB
(1 TB)
12K µop
Execution
Trace Cache;
16 KB L1;
1 MB L2,
8 MB L3
Intel Pentium 4
Processor
Extreme Edition
Supporting
Hyper-
Threading
Technology
2005 Intel NetBurst
Microarchitecture;
Hyper-Threading
Technology; Intel
64 Architecture
3.73 GHz 164 M GP: 32, 64
FPU: 80
MMX: 64
XMM: 128
8.5 GB/s 64 GB 12K µop
Execution
Trace Cache;
16 KB L1;
2 MB L2
Intel Pentium
Processor
Extreme Edition
840
2005 Intel NetBurst
Microarchitecture;
Hyper-Threading
Technology; Intel
64 Architecture;
Dual-core
2
3.20 GHz 230 M GP: 32, 64
FPU: 80
MMX: 64
XMM: 128
6.4 GB/s 64 GB 12K µop
Execution
Trace Cache;
16 KB L1;
1MB L2 (2MB
Tota l)